About

Kathryn (Kathy) McDonald

I am passionate about helping clients find the awareness, insight, and resilience they need to overcome challenges and live a joyful, meaningful, and fulfilling life. My approach in counseling is based on ensuring you feel you are in a supportive space so you can explore your current thoughts and feelings, process past experiences, and envision and achieve your goals. I work with adults who are struggling with a variety of issues including anxiety, depression, life transitions, stress, career issues, grief/loss, and relationship issues. I am trained in and use research-based techniques including: CBT, EMDR, MBCT, IFS, Gottman method, as well as psychodynamic and humanistic approaches. Along with these research-based techniques, I bring creative and integrative thinking to offer therapy tailored to the uniqueness of each client. As a former business consultant to Fortune 500 companies, I also have a deep understanding of clients dealing with the demands of high-pressure careers and job stress. My education includes: MS Counseling and Development, Texas Woman's University; MS in Marketing and Communication, Northwestern University; Bachelor's Behavioral Sciences, Indiana University. I am also a Registered Yoga Teacher (RYT-200) and often combine relaxation and breathing techniques with psychotherapy to address the mind-body connection necessary to achieve emotional wellbeing. In accordance with Texas law (House Bill 4224 and Section 181.105 of the Texas Health and Safety Code), the following information is provided to help consumers understand their rights and available resources: Requesting Your Health Care Records - You have the right to request a copy of your mental health records. To request your records, please submit a written request to me directly. Requests may be made via email, secure client portal, or in writing. Records will be provided in accordance with Texas law and applicable privacy regulations. If you have questions about accessing your records, please contact me for assistance. Contacting the Texas Behavioral Health Executive Council (BHEC): The Texas Behavioral Health Executive Council regulates licensed mental health professionals in Texas. If you have questions about licensure or professional standards, you may contact BHEC directly at Texas Behavioral Health Executive Council – https://bhec.texas.gov/contact-us/ Filing a Consumer Complaint: If you wish to file a consumer complaint regarding mental health services, you may do so with the Texas Office of the Attorney General at https://www.texasattorneygeneral.gov/consumer-protection​
